Indian cricket fans have been a divided bunch for the past few days. This Sunday we witnessed the mega clash between Mumbai Indians and Royal Challengers Bangalore. The game was won by the home side by 8 wickets thanks to half centuries from captain Faf Du Plessis and former skipper Virat Kohli. The focus from the match isn’t dying due to all the incidents which came to light after the end of the game.

The story as it happened –

Mumbai Indians skipper Rohit Sharma was playing his 200th in T20 cricket as a skipper of the side. This year the 35 year old will complete ten years as the captain of the blue and gold team. it wasn’t an happy start to the tournament as the Mumbai team lost yet another opening encounter at the start of an IPL season.

Kohli’s unnoticed ‘Helmet Pe Maar’ jibe comes to light –

 The game on Sunday saw an unpleasant view as few fans from RCB decided to fat shame Rohit Sharma. There videos of the Indian and MI captain being called “Vada Pav”. Now there is a new footage which has come up and in this Virat Kohli can be heard screaming to Mohammad Siraj “Helmet pe maar iske”. This was after Rohit had taken a single of the 1st ball of the game and gone down to the other end.


Fans divided over the new video

While many fans on social media called this normal part of the game, they did not find the latest video against the nature of the game. Many fans on the other hand did not like Virat Kohli’s aggressive stance against his own national captain and called it uncalled for. The latest video has divided the fanbase even more.

Fans go head to head on social media after insult to Rohit Sharma

Indian fans have been at loggerheads ever since the “Vada Pav” chants at Bangalore. While Virat Kohli fans have been basking in the win over MI on Sunday, the Mumbai Indians fans have taken offence to the insult towards Rohit Sharma.
